This type tube-in-tube sample water coolers can be used specific in high pressure sample in combination with high pressure cooling fluid.



Liquid and gas analysers need a sample in a specific temperature range. When this temperature is different from your process temperature, a sample cooler is sometimes required.

Helical Coil Water Coolers

The helical coil cooler (heat exchangers) cools a sample from a process stream. Typical design with spiral small diameter tube and shell heat exchanger accordingly to ASME PTC 19.11. The sample to be cooled flows through the tube side of the cooler, and the cooling fluid flows through the shell side. We offer Herpi and Sentry helical coil coolers.

Applications to max. 540°C (higher on request).

Available with coils in Inconel, Monel or other Alloys for high Chloride content cooling water or high chemical samples. 

===

  • Flows from 1 L/hr to 340 L/h
  • Pressure ratings up to 345 bar (5,000 psi)
  • Temperature ratings up to 593°C (1100°F)
  • Available using single tube helical coil, multi-tube spiral tube, or tube-in-tube heat exchanger designs.
  • Sample tube/coil materials, SS304, SS316/316L or S.Duplex, Alloy 625 / 825 (Inconel), Monel 400, Hastelloy C276
  • Tube/coils in 6 mm or 1/4" and 1/2" OD
  • Specific water chemistry could dictate different materials for improved corrosion resistance, e.g. Alloy 600 for high chlorides in the cooling water.
  • Sample coolers with NACE MR0175 or NACE MR0103 standards for sour gas or liquid (H2S) applications.

Tube-in-Tube Water Coolers

Tube-in-tube cooler (heat exchangers) are spirally wound, full counter flow heat exchangers well suited for a variety of applications where low flow rates of high temperature and/or high pressure fluids need cooling or heating. Also known as DTC (dual tube coil). We offer  Sentry tube-in-tube coolers.

Forced Airflow Coolers

The Airfin cooler is available in natural convection and forced air fin designs with a cooling area of 2.5 m² (26.8 ft²).

Lower operating costs ensured by air-cooling technology that eliminates water treatment and disposal.

Improved reliability with cooling water-free design, which prevents accidental shutoff and winter freeze-up. Minimal installation and maintenance costs with unit design that requires less piping and is less susceptible to fouling.

Custom Made Water Coolers

The helical coil water cooler (heat exchangers) cools a sample from a process stream. Typical custom design with spiral big diameter tube or pipe and open shell heat exchanger.

Cost-effective application flexibility with multiple corrosion-resistant material options for the coil and shell construction

Sample Gas Coolers / Conditioning Systems

Electrical cooling system, typical refrigerated and thermoelectric coolers for highest demands of sample gas quality control. Best choice for permanent separation of the condensate from the gas phase, as well as the shorter contact time of the gas in the system, play important roles to measure extreme low concentrations of gas elements.
